41 /*
42  * /dev/fd Filesystem
43  */
44 
45 #include <sys/param.h>
46 #include <sys/systm.h>
47 #include <sys/time.h>
48 #include <sys/types.h>
49 #include <sys/proc.h>
50 #include <sys/resourcevar.h>
51 #include <sys/filedesc.h>
52 #include <sys/vnode.h>
53 #include <sys/mount.h>
54 #include <sys/namei.h>
55 #include <sys/malloc.h>
56 #include <miscfs/fdesc/fdesc.h>
57 
58 /*
59  * Mount the per-process file descriptors (/dev/fd)
60  */
61 int
62 fdesc_mount(mp, path, data, ndp, p)
63 	struct mount *mp;
64 	char *path;
65 	caddr_t data;
66 	struct nameidata *ndp;
67 	struct proc *p;
68 {
69 	int error = 0;
70 	u_int size;
71 	struct fdescmount *fmp;
72 	struct vnode *rvp;
73 
74 	/*
75 	 * Update is a no-op
76 	 */
77 	if (mp->mnt_flag & MNT_UPDATE)
78 		return (EOPNOTSUPP);
79 
80 	error = fdesc_allocvp(Froot, FD_ROOT, mp, &rvp);
81 	if (error)
82 		return (error);
83 
84 	MALLOC(fmp, struct fdescmount *, sizeof(struct fdescmount),
85 				M_UFSMNT, M_WAITOK);	/* XXX */
86 	rvp->v_type = VDIR;
87 	rvp->v_flag |= VROOT;
88 	fmp->f_root = rvp;
89 	/* XXX -- don't mark as local to work around fts() problems */
90 	/*mp->mnt_flag |= MNT_LOCAL;*/
91 	mp->mnt_data = (qaddr_t) fmp;
92 	getnewfsid(mp, MOUNT_FDESC);
93 
94 	(void) copyinstr(path, mp->mnt_stat.f_mntonname, MNAMELEN - 1, &size);
95 	bzero(mp->mnt_stat.f_mntonname + size, MNAMELEN - size);
96 	bzero(mp->mnt_stat.f_mntfromname, MNAMELEN);
97 	bcopy("fdesc", mp->mnt_stat.f_mntfromname, sizeof("fdesc"));
98 	return (0);
99 }

110 int
111 fdesc_unmount(mp, mntflags, p)
112 	struct mount *mp;
113 	int mntflags;
114 	struct proc *p;
115 {
116 	int error;
117 	int flags = 0;
118 	extern int doforce;
119 	struct vnode *rootvp = VFSTOFDESC(mp)->f_root;
120 
121 	if (mntflags & MNT_FORCE) {
122 		/* fdesc can never be rootfs so don't check for it */
123 		if (!doforce)
124 			return (EINVAL);
125 		flags |= FORCECLOSE;
126 	}
127 
128 	/*
129 	 * Clear out buffer cache.  I don't think we
130 	 * ever get anything cached at this level at the
131 	 * moment, but who knows...
132 	 */
133 	if (rootvp->v_usecount > 1)
134 		return (EBUSY);
135 	if (error = vflush(mp, rootvp, flags))
136 		return (error);
137 
138 	/*
139 	 * Release reference on underlying root vnode
140 	 */
141 	vrele(rootvp);
142 	/*
143 	 * And blow it away for future re-use
144 	 */
145 	vgone(rootvp);
146 	/*
147 	 * Finally, throw away the fdescmount structure
148 	 */
149 	free(mp->mnt_data, M_UFSMNT);	/* XXX */
150 	mp->mnt_data = 0;
151 
152 	return (0);
153 }

184 int
185 fdesc_statfs(mp, sbp, p)
186 	struct mount *mp;
187 	struct statfs *sbp;
188 	struct proc *p;
189 {
190 	struct filedesc *fdp;
191 	int lim;
192 	int i;
193 	int last;
194 	int freefd;
195 
196 	/*
197 	 * Compute number of free file descriptors.
198 	 * [ Strange results will ensue if the open file
199 	 * limit is ever reduced below the current number
200 	 * of open files... ]
201 	 */
202 	lim = p->p_rlimit[RLIMIT_NOFILE].rlim_cur;
203 	fdp = p->p_fd;
204 	last = min(fdp->fd_nfiles, lim);
205 	freefd = 0;
206 	for (i = fdp->fd_freefile; i < last; i++)
207 		if (fdp->fd_ofiles[i] == NULL)
208 			freefd++;
209 
210 	/*
211 	 * Adjust for the fact that the fdesc array may not
212 	 * have been fully allocated yet.
213 	 */
214 	if (fdp->fd_nfiles < lim)
215 		freefd += (lim - fdp->fd_nfiles);
216 
217 	sbp->f_type = MOUNT_FDESC;
218 	sbp->f_flags = 0;
219 	sbp->f_bsize = DEV_BSIZE;
220 	sbp->f_iosize = DEV_BSIZE;
221 	sbp->f_blocks = 2;		/* 1K to keep df happy */
222 	sbp->f_bfree = 0;
223 	sbp->f_bavail = 0;
224 	sbp->f_files = lim + 1;		/* Allow for "." */
225 	sbp->f_ffree = freefd;		/* See comments above */
226 	if (sbp != &mp->mnt_stat) {
227 		bcopy(&mp->mnt_stat.f_fsid, &sbp->f_fsid, sizeof(sbp->f_fsid));
228 		bcopy(mp->mnt_stat.f_mntonname, sbp->f_mntonname, MNAMELEN);
229 		bcopy(mp->mnt_stat.f_mntfromname, sbp->f_mntfromname, MNAMELEN);
230 	}
231 	return (0);
232 }
